This is the ONLY one with adjustable footrest!!!!4
I just received my Graco Quattro Tour Samba and I have to say, I love it! It has everything the other Quattro Tour Deluxes have EXCEPT...this is the only one, yes the only one that also has an adjustable footrest, which was the main factor for my decision to buy this stroller.

The footrest also goes all they way up and makes a bassinet kind of space for the baby so you don't have to use the car seat all the time. I am actually planning to put the baby in facing me which seems absolutely possible...in fact in Europe the Quattro Tour Strollers are being used with a carrycot and a little fabric flap on top of the canopy to make it into a carriage. That's how I got the idea for turning the baby around.

The fabric is beautiful, very stylish, for moms and dads - and best of all - easy to clean. You can wipe it clean or throw the whole cover in the wash.

The Quattro steers wonderfully and I find the height of the handles just right (I am 5'4 - they are on the high side - perfect for either my husband, who is a little bigger or me)...too bad they didn't make it adjustable like in many other strollers.

The canopy is awesome...it's HUGE...and it rotates all the way with no problems so your child is protected from the sun from any angle.

The basket is huge and seems very sturdy. It can be lowered when the backrest is fully reclined which is very practical.
In the parent console is a time and temperature tracker which is not really necessary but a nice thing to have anyways...

I didn't give the stroller 5 stars because the backrest is way to low - my 2 1/2 year old is way above it (and he is average height). It just doesn't make sense to me why they would extend the weight range of the new strollers to 50lbs. but not change the size of the backrest.

I figure this is just going to be our travel system, first year and a half kind of stroller, depending of the size of our baby.

Other than that, if you are looking for a stroller with tons of features that looks stylish and even matches an amazing infant car seat (Graco SafeSeat) - this is the one. It's definitely worth the money.

Wheel assemblies break easily - replacements are very slow to arrive1
I've had a Graco Quattro stroller for 18 months and have just had to order a replacement front wheel assembly for the second time. The plastic piece that connects the front wheels to the metal frame cracks easily. Graco charges more than $25 to ship you a replacement. The first time the wheel assembly cracked it took almost a month for the replacement part to arrive. This time they tell me it could take almost two months. They tell me that this is because the parts come from Asia - they had no satisfactory answer when I asked why they could not anticipate demand and keep them in stock. This is highly unsatisfactory, especially considering the cost of the stroller. I will not be buying any Graco products again and would not recommend them.
